BURLINGTON, Vt. (WCAX) - Black Cap Coffee’s store on Burlington’s Church Street is closing for good.

It comes after workers walked out Saturday over what they say are unfair labor practices, but the owner says the decision to close was not related to the strike.

Workers said they held the strike to fight back at the company’s targeting of unionized workers in mass layoffs to discourage unionization.

Employees at the Church Street location unionized earlier this year and have spent the last nine months negotiating contracts.

Black Cap owner Laura Vilalta recently announced the closure of the Burlington location at the end of December , just before workers are set to receive their annual raise.
